Guess what?: Brandon impresses with '€˜Heart Beat'€™

JP/Arief Suhadirman

Actor Brandon Salim shows his showmanship in his second film Heart Beat, in which he not only acts but also plays the guitar.

'€œI love the story, it sends a positive message. I always like music-themed drama,'€ he said as quoted by Kapanlagi.com on Thursday.

Brandon, the oldest child of veteran actor Ferry Salim, is also a musician.

The 19-year-old is the star of webseries Anak Artis (Celebrities'€™ Kids) and appeared in 7 Hari Menembus Waktu (Seven Days Going through Time) with fellow teen actors Anjani Dina and Teuku Rassya and his father.

In teen movie Heart Beat, Brandon assumes the role of a musician performing in a café with a friend called Lexa. '€œThe film is about friendship, telling us to stay true to our friends and to be tolerant with them. It fits with the tagline: a friend is a relative that we choose,'€ he said.

Heart Beat will start screening at local theaters Nov. 12.
